Commit f24e2a46 authored by knn's avatar knn Committed by Commit bot

Add policy_templates target for GN.

BUG=462362

Review URL: https://codereview.chromium.org/957283003

Cr-Commit-Position: refs/heads/master@{#319616}
parent c704e169
...@@ -117,6 +117,26 @@ if (enable_configuration_policy) { ...@@ -117,6 +117,26 @@ if (enable_configuration_policy) {
] ]
} }
grit("policy_templates") {
import("resources/policy_templates.gni")
source = "resources/policy_templates.grd"
use_qualified_include = true
output_dir = "$root_gen_dir/chrome"
outputs = policy_templates_doc_outputs
if (is_android) {
outputs += policy_templates_android_outputs
}
if (is_linux) {
outputs += policy_templates_linux_outputs
}
if (is_mac) {
outputs += policy_templates_mac_outputs
}
if (is_win) {
outputs += policy_templates_windows_outputs
}
}
proto_library("cloud_policy_proto_generated_compile") { proto_library("cloud_policy_proto_generated_compile") {
sources = [ sources = [
cloud_policy_proto_path, cloud_policy_proto_path,
...@@ -218,4 +238,4 @@ if (enable_configuration_policy) { ...@@ -218,4 +238,4 @@ if (enable_configuration_policy) {
] ]
} }
} }
#TODO(GYP) policy templates, chrome_manifest_bundle #TODO(GYP) chrome_manifest_bundle
This diff is collapsed.
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ment